How to Add Multiple Linked Reels in One Reel

Posted in

If you have several Instagram Reels that belong together, sending people off to hunt through your profile for part two, part three, or the next related tip isn’t exactly ideal. Instagram’s Edits app now gives you another option. You can add several Reels inside one new Reel and make each one clickable. A viewer can tap one of the smaller Reels, watch the full video, then return to the original Reel to choose another. What’s the RIGHT Size Carousel in Canva for Instagram?

Posted in

If you’re creating Instagram graphics in Canva, you may have noticed something confusing: Canva gives you more than one portrait size for an Instagram post. So which one should you use? The 4:5 vs 3:4 Instagram post size choice matters because your image can look perfectly fine while someone is scrolling through their Instagram feed, but look different once it appears on your profile grid. The two sizes Krista compares in this video are 1080 x 1350 pixels (4:5) and 1080 x 1440 pixels (3:4). How to Create a Comment Reply Reel in Instagram

Posted in

Want to turn a follower’s comment into a new reel? It’s super easy and a great way to keep the conversation going on your page. Here’s how you do it: Step 1:Go to the post with the comment you want to reply to. It can be a reel, a carousel, or a photo. Step 2:Find the comment you want to use. Press and hold on the comment and hit reply. OR hit reply under the comment. Step 3:Tap the little camera icon on the left-hand side.
